Output 59eb4e5031a2d41ffbbcee2e57cf39189b7d218e7341bb7d65e7e7f85d88db02:0

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cbb17545951c747200c80c87286a8bc396bb58 OP_EQUAL
address
3CLaKeWDqWoTMbV4i5bNjRbxAeokY8XdAT
transaction
59eb4e5031a2d41ffbbcee2e57cf39189b7d218e7341bb7d65e7e7f85d88db02
confirmations
175323
spent
true